Last week I hiked on a whim,
choosing a trail just above the sea.
I passed gulls gossiping like old men
and jumped crags deeper than a tall me
while the wind capered across the water
and light danced about the waves with glee.
Diverted, I worried the journey would end too soon,
but on rounding the bend, I found eternity.

San Diego Coastline

Rippling down the coast
in blues and grays, the ocean
laps on sandy shores
today, tomorrow, and so
on to perpetuity.

K – Kayak

 

The red kayak floated calmly

on the blue green waters of the sea,Red Kayak

at peace for once today – finally! no one’s

sitting inside. The ceaseless duns

are over! At least for now. Tomorrow,

someone will come and sink the keel low.

But, at this moment, weightless and free,

the red kayak was in tranquility.
